Walnuts Grow Where. Walnut, genus of about 20 species of deciduous trees of the family juglandaceae, native to north and south america, southern europe, asia, and the west indies. Walnuts are primarily grown in the united states, china, and iran, but they are also cultivated in countries like turkey, india, and.
